Parma has one of the largest Polish-American populations of any US city — roughly 25% of residents identify as Polish or of Polish descent. The city's 'Polish Village' along Ridge Road is home to Polish restaurants, bakeries, butcher shops, and Catholic churches. The annual Parma Polish Festival is one of the largest Polish-American cultural events in the country. The Cleveland comedy scene has endlessly mined Parma for jokes — it's a beloved local stereotype.

What's the Polish Village like?
Ridge Road in Parma is the heart of the Polish community — Seven Roses Polish Deli, Fragapane Bakery, Polish Village Shop, and multiple Catholic parish churches (St. Charles Borromeo, Transfiguration) anchor the community. Pierogies, kielbasa, and paczki (Polish donuts) are widely available. The community hosts multi-day festivals. The concentration of Polish identity in Parma is distinctive even for Cleveland's Eastern European heritage.
